Autism spectrum disorder (ASD) is a complex developmental disability; signs typically appear during early childhood and affect a person’s ability to communicate, and interact with others. This past week San Perlita Baseball and Softball took a moment to raise awareness of autism and honor some young men and women from their community who have Austism. Students at San Perlita ISD who have autism threw out the first pitch at the baseball and softball games and had a chance to run the bases. According to the Autism Society, early detection can change lives. Here are some signs to look for in the children in your life:.
Thank you San Perlita Athletics for doing your part to raise awareness of Autism.
